Should I give my dog amoxicillin for his pyoderma skin infection?

Pet's info: Dog | American Pit Bull Terrier | Male | unneutered | 9 months and 24 days old | 40 lbs

Can I give my dog amoxicillin for his pyoderma?

Yes, but I prefer cephalexin or cefpodoxime for skin infection. The amoxicillin dose for a dog 40lbs would be about 200mg every 12 hours. I would recommend seeing a vet though for appropriate antibiotic therapy recommendations. Topical therapy should also be considered. I typically recommend using a shampoo such as Douxo PS chlorhexidine combination shampoo and bathe twice weekly until the infection is resolved. I also recommend using welactin omega 3 fish oil and essential 6 spot on by dermoscent. Malacetic conditioning spray is also a good option to spray isolated areas on the body where infection is present. I hope this helps guide you in the right direction.
